Apply for Bingo Host Position in Luleå – Part Time
IDROTTENS BINGO I GÖTEBORG ABNorrbottens län, Luleå
Previous experience is desired
Do you like being in the center of attention, taking responsibility, and spreading joy? Apply for the position of Bingo Host in Luleå!
Our Bingo Hosts are our face to the public. It is their commitment and sense of service that make our guests feel welcome. As a Bingo Host, you will have the opportunity to develop socially, as no two shifts are alike. At the same time, you will take responsibility and work independently, as we believe that responsibility helps people grow. The role involves sales, putting the guest first, and ensuring a positive gaming experience.
We provide internal training for all new employees, so previous work experience is not required, although it is an advantage. Most importantly, you must be willing to give us your commitment. In return, we help build your CV, support your development, and provide a fun work environment. All our surplus goes to sports. Since 1979, Idrottens Bingo has donated over 1.3 billion SEK to the sports community. This is another reason why it is fun to work with us.
We are looking for someone who is service-oriented, flexible, ambitious, stress-resistant, and capable of working independently, as you will mostly work alone. It is a plus if you are comfortable speaking into a microphone in front of people and have a bit of "street smarts". Mental arithmetic and handling money should not be a problem, and the ability to connect with people is a must.
Your duties include, but are not limited to, brick sales, café sales, entertaining guests, cleaning, and Bingo reporting.
As we are a small team working closely together, we place great emphasis on your personal qualities. A team spirit is essential here, and it is important that you value collaboration.
Interviews will be conducted on an ongoing basis.
Our halls are open most days of the year. The position of Bingo Host involves shift work during the day, evening, and weekends. This is a part-time position of approximately 15–20 hours per week.
Requirements for the position are that you are at least 18 years old, speak Swedish, are focused on work, and wish to develop within sales and service.
